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Adantic White-Sided Dolphin | northern night monkey |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Mammalia (Mammals)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Cetacea (Whales & Dolphins) | Primates (Primates) |
| Family | Delphinidae (Oceanic Dolphins) | Aotidae |
| Genus | Lagenorhynchus | Aotus |
| Species | Lagenorhynchus acutus | Aotus trivirgatus |
Evolutionary Relationship
Adantic White-Sided Dolphin and northern night monkey share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(Mammals)
